A 27-year-old pregnant woman, Shilpa Panchangamath, was found dead in South Bengaluru, sparking allegations of dowry harassment and murder. Shilpa, who earlier worked at Infosys, had married Praveen, a former Oracle engineer-turned-panipuri seller, in December 2022. They had a 1.5-year-old son.

Her family alleged that they had spent Rs. 35 lakh on the wedding, given 150g gold, and even sold their Rs. 40 lakh house and later paid Rs. 10 lakh more to meet demands. Despite this, Praveen and his mother allegedly kept harassing Shilpa for more money and humiliated her over her skin tone.

Days before her death, Praveen allegedly left home saying he was traveling, after which Shilpa was found dead. Her uncle claimed it was murder, not suicide, pointing to inconsistencies at the scene.
Police have registered a case of dowry death and harassment; Praveen is being questioned.
